美文网首页Python
Python操作mysql

Python操作mysql

作者: coder_jin | 来源:发表于2017-12-05 17:39 被阅读0次

#encoding=utf-8

#author jinxudong@xdf.cn

importMySQLdb

#mysqlsql查询

defqueryfrommysql(table,sql):

conn=MySQLdb.connect(

host='localhost',

port=3306,

user='root',

passwd='1',

db=table,

charset='utf8'

)

cur=conn.cursor()

cur.execute(sql)

data=cur.fetchall()

returndata

cur.close()

conn.close()

#增改操作mysql

defcommittomysql(dbname,sql,values):

conn = MySQLdb.connect(

host='localhost',

port=3306,

user='root',

passwd='1',

db=dbname,

charset='utf8'

)

cur = conn.cursor()

cur.execute(sql,values)

conn.commit()

cur.close()

conn.close()

# 删除表数据

deftruncattable(dbname,sql):

conn = MySQLdb.connect(

host='localhost',

port=3306,

user='root',

passwd='1',

db=dbname,

charset='utf8'

)

cur = conn.cursor()

cur.execute(sql)

conn.commit()

cur.close()

conn.close()

#dbname="test"

#sql="insert into employee values(%s,%s,%s)"

#values=('15fds','2','3')

#committomysql(dbname,sql,values)

相关文章

  • 使用 pymysql 进行增删查改

    参考文章 用python实现接口测试(四、操作MySQL) python3使用pymysql操作mysql 安装 ...

  • mysql+python

    安装MySQL-python 要想使python可以操作mysql 就需要MySQL-python驱动,它是pyt...

  • pycharm连接mysql

    python操作MySQL(简单流程)

  • 05-Mysql数据库03

    mysql与python交互 拆表 python中操作mysql 安装pymysqlsudo pip instal...

  • 搜企网爬虫作业

    作业要求 (1)csv文件数据写入(2)mysql 操作,python mysql操作 这个需要安装mysql以及...

  • (十四) 学习笔记: 使用Python对Mysql Mongo

    一. Python对MySQL的操作 (1) 安装模块pip install pymysql(2) 操作mysql...

  • python作业-20170601

    作业:(1)csv文件数据写入(2)mysql 操作,python mysql操作 这个需要安装mysql以及p...

  • MySQL&python交互

    MySQL&python交互 一、Python操作MySQL步骤(原始的执行SQL语句) 引入pymysql模块 ...

  • Python3-mysql

    此文章记录一下python对mysql的一些操作方式、方法。 *python如何连接mysql ? python ...

  • Python操作MySQL

    Python操作MySQL 一. python操作数据库介绍 Python 标准数据库接口为 Python DB-...

网友评论

    本文标题:Python操作mysql

    本文链接:https://www.haomeiwen.com/subject/kqwcixtx.html